The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in England with a requirement for Multithreaded Programming sk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Multithreaded Programming over the 6 months to 23 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
23 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 740 816 794
Rank change year-on-year +76 -22 -45
Permanent jobs citing Multithreaded Programming 96 134 349
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in England 0.11% 0.14% 0.27%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.13% 0.15% 0.28%
Number of salaries quoted 87 113 220
10th Percentile £47,000 £47,000 £42,500
25th Percentile £55,000 £65,000 £70,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£60,000 £97,500 £98,750
Median % change year-on-year -38.46% -1.27% +16.18%
75th Percentile £100,000 £120,000 £120,625
90th Percentile £137,500 £147,500 £138,750
UK median annual salary £60,000 £97,500 £101,250
% change year-on-year -38.46% -3.70% +19.12%
